Overview of Dr. Ryan Richards, MD

Dr. Ryan Richards, MD is an Orthopedic Surgery Specialist in Provo, UT. They specialize in Orthopedic Surgery, has 25 years of experience, and is board certified in Hand Surgery. They graduated from ALBANY MEDICAL COLLEGE and is affiliated with Mountain View Hospital and Lone Peak Hospital. Dr. Richards, completed a residency at Maricopa Medical Center. Patients rated Dr. Richards an average 4.5 star rating.

Dr. Richards works at Revere Health - Provo Main Campus in Provo, UT with other offices in Lehi, UT. They are accepting new patients. Please call ahead to schedule an appointment and to confirm all accepted insurance plans.

    What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

    A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
